Climate impact — Hot & Humid
High heat combined with humidity creates a challenging environment for vinyl wraps. Moisture can work under edges and seams, weakening adhesive bonds over time. The combination of UV exposure and humid air also accelerates color degradation compared to dry climates. Quality installation with properly sealed edges is critical here — ask your installer about edge-sealing techniques and whether they use heat guns for post-installation finishing.
Expected wrap lifespan in Palm Bay: 4–6 years · Best season to wrap: November through March

How much does a car wrap cost in Palm Bay?
A full car wrap in Palm Bay, FL typically costs $2,500–$6,000 depending on vehicle size, wrap material, and finish. Partial wraps start around $500–$2,000. Premium materials like 3M 2080 or Avery Supreme cost more but last 5–7 years. Get free quotes from 2 local shops on CarWrapHub to compare pricing.

How long does a car wrap last in Palm Bay?
In Palm Bay's hot, humid climate, premium wraps last 4–6 years. Humidity weakens adhesive bonds at edges over time. Regular edge inspections and avoiding pressure washing near seams help. Mid-grade wraps last 2–4 years.

What is the best car wrap material for Palm Bay's climate?
In Palm Bay's humid climate, 3M 2080 and KPMF offer the best edge-seal adhesion. Avery Supreme's conformability handles curves well in heat. Avoid solvent-based films that can outgas in humidity.
